Verify Before You Trust
Check any claim on the State's own site.
Every first contact from us includes a Property ID so you can confirm the money is real — on claimit.ca.gov, the State of California's official unclaimed-property site — before you sign or share anything. Here is exactly how, in about two minutes.
1. Go to claimit.ca.gov directly
Type claimit.ca.gov into your browser yourself rather than clicking a link in any email — ours included. That habit protects you from imposters everywhere, not just here.
2. Search for the Property ID
Use the site's property search and enter the Property ID exactly as it appears in our letter or email. You can also search your business's name and see everything the State holds for it. Searching is free and requires no account.
3. Confirm the details match
The record should show your business as the owner, with an amount consistent with what we told you. If anything doesn't match — or the ID isn't there at all — stop and walk away. That's the standard we hold ourselves to.
4. Look us up while you're at it
Our business registration is public record on the California Secretary of State's site at bizfileonline.sos.ca.gov. The State Controller's own consumer guidance on unclaimed-property investigators — including the fee rules that bind us — is at sco.ca.gov. We'd rather you check than take our word for it.
